Contents Why should we care so much about concussion? -- Managing sports-related concussion in the youth and adolescent athlete : public health concerns -- Clinical evaluation and return to play dilemma : will making the right decision today be the right decision for romorrow -- Q & A.
Abstract The (4) presentations from the Clinical Lecture at the 2009 ACSM annual meeting on what can be done to effectively manage a sports-related concussion in young athletes are included on a single DVD. Almost one hour of authoritative information and insights, featuring: Managing Sports-Related Concussion in Youth and Adolescent Athletes, Why Should We Care So Much About a Concussion? (Kevin Guskiewicz), Public Health Concerns (Stanley Herring), Clinical Evaluation and Return to Play Dilemma (Margot Putukian).
